That’s where Megan Mbengue enters the picture! Megan is the Founder of Trusted Canna Nurse, and she a nationally certified in hospice and palliative care who worked at The Johns Hopkins Hospital in Baltimore, Maryland. Currently living in Southern California, Megan maximizes her decade of experience in nursing to provide an alternative medicine experience to patients through various cannabis applications. Tune in as Megan shares her nursing journey, the sad reality of the current state of nurses in the healthcare industry, the battle of pharmaceuticals vs. alternative medications, and so much more!

Jessica Funcheon is the owner and licensed massage therapist at Carmel Restorative Massage Studios in Carmel, Indiana. Their main mission and purpose is to help people with chronic pain find relief through massage and Hemp-Derived CBD Products. Using her unique methods, Jessica is helping the cannabis community in Indiana evolve. In her experience, she attests to even seeing clients with Fibromyalgia find relief. In addition, she strongly believes that massage is an important element in helping alleviate chronic pain and stress. By using full-spectrum Hemp CBD topical in her pain relief practices she aims to change the stigma.
